My Buying Guides on Stainless Interior Microwave Oven

Why I Chose a Stainless Interior Microwave Oven

When I started looking for a new microwave oven, I quickly realized that the interior material matters more than I first thought. I wanted something that was durable, easy to clean, and less likely to stain or retain odors. A stainless interior stood out to me because it feels more premium and holds up well over time. In my experience, it also gives the microwave a cleaner look and makes maintenance much easier.

What I Looked for First

The first thing I considered was how I planned to use the microwave. I asked myself whether I needed it mainly for reheating, defrosting, or cooking full meals. That helped me decide on the right size, power level, and features. I learned that choosing based on my daily routine made the buying process much easier.

Capacity and Size

I paid close attention to the interior capacity because I wanted a microwave that could fit my plates, bowls, and casserole dishes comfortably. Smaller models work well for simple reheating, but I found that a medium or larger capacity is better if I cook often or use bigger containers. I also made sure to measure the space in my kitchen before buying, so I would not end up with a microwave that was too large for the counter or cabinet.

Power and Cooking Performance

For me, wattage was one of the most important factors. I noticed that higher wattage usually means faster and more even cooking. I preferred a model with enough power to heat food quickly without leaving cold spots. If I were buying again, I would still aim for a microwave with at least moderate to high wattage for better performance.

Ease of Cleaning

One reason I liked the stainless interior was how easy it is to wipe clean. Spills and splatters happen often in my kitchen, so I wanted a surface that would not absorb odors or stain easily. I found that a smooth stainless interior makes cleanup simpler and helps the microwave stay looking new for longer.

Durability and Build Quality

I also looked at how solid the microwave felt overall. A stainless interior usually suggests better durability, but I still checked the door, buttons, handle, and turntable to make sure everything felt sturdy. In my experience, a well-built microwave lasts longer and gives me more confidence in daily use.

Useful Features I Considered

Some features made a big difference in my decision. I looked for:

  • Pre-programmed cooking settings
  • Defrost options
  • Child lock for safety
  • Sensor cooking
  • Express start or quick-start buttons
  • Interior lighting for better visibility

I found that these features made the microwave easier and more convenient to use, especially on busy days.

Noise Level

I did not want a microwave that sounded too loud every time I used it. While most microwaves make some noise, I paid attention to reviews and product details to find one that operated at a comfortable sound level. For me, a quieter microwave is more pleasant, especially in an open kitchen.

Style and Finish

Since the microwave would be visible in my kitchen, I cared about appearance too. A stainless steel exterior matched my appliances nicely, and the stainless interior gave it a polished feel. I liked choosing a model that looked modern while still being practical.

Price and Value

I compared several models to see which one offered the best value for my budget. I learned that the cheapest option is not always the best choice if it lacks durability or useful features. For me, it was worth paying a little more for a microwave that felt reliable, easy to clean, and efficient.
